Outstanding Advantages Of 3D Printing Devices

3D printing

In the past few years 3D printing technology came up and became widespread on the Internet overnight and entered the field of perception of everyday people. But in fact in 1986, the United States produced the first industrial 3D Printer. Over the next twenty years, scientists from various countries have continued to study and create 3D printing technology, which has resulted in the rapid development of 3D printing technology, as well as the constant expansion of applications areas, such as industrial manufacturing, aerospace Aviation, automotive, architecture, design medical, etc. have applications. The 3D printing technology has slowly entered homes and schools, becoming small appliances. What are the advantages of 3D printing?

Design without limits

Traditional manufacturing methods and craftsmen are restricted to the shapes of their products. The tools designers use frequently limit the possibilities of their designs. The majority of designs are only feasible only in the imagination or on paper. But 3D printing technology is able to overcome these limitations and open up vast design possibilities and offer designers to design whatever they like.

No assembly is required

The model is able to be integrated with three-dimensional printer. A hinge and door can both be printed simultaneously using the layered manufacturing. If the printing process is more complex or delicate, the door and matching hinge can be printed at the same time without assembly. However, assembly can still be useful. Eliminating the assembly can reduce the supply chain, and it also saves labor and transport costs. The shorter the supply chain, less pollution.

Zero time distribution

3D printers can print on demand. Even if production reduces company's inventory, companies may also utilize 3D printers to create exclusive products to satisfy customer demands. Innovative business models are feasible. Zero-time delivery is feasible when products are manufactured close to the market. This reduces long-distance transport costs.

An exact physical copy

Rapid Prototyping 3D Printer is able to accurately and precisely finish the physical duplicate. This printer is used often to restore and preservation of the cultural heritage. The utilization of 3D scanners and 3D printing technology could enable the transformation between physical and digital world, and increase the resolution. We can scan, edit and even copy physical objects, make exact copies, or optimize the originals.
